O livro A temática ambiental na escola e os artefatos da indústria cultural apresenta uma reflexão sobre o modo como a crise ambiental vivenciada na atualidade pode demonstrar, de forma evidente, que o modelo de relação historicamente edificado entre seres humanos e natureza tornou-se destrutivo e insustentável. Considera-se que esse modelo de relação foi altamente influenciado pelo desenvolvimento da ciência moderna que, desde os seus primórdios, busca o domínio da natureza com o objetivo de conhecê-la. Nesse sentido, destacam-se as contribuições de cientistas como Francis Bacon, Galileu Galilei, René Descartes e Isaac Newton, que efetivamente alteraram a forma como o ser humano se relacionaria com o mundo externo. A obra discute também como a modernidade se constituiu, dialeticamente, a partir do domínio da razão instrumental e do progresso tecnológico da ciência, subordinando a ela os destinos da humanidade. A partir das contribuições da Teoria Crítica, a autora busca compreender o papel desempenhado pela educação no processo de emancipação dos indivíduos diante dos ditames da indústria cultural e da sociedade de consumo, cujos discursos "ecologicamente corretos" visam a fidelizar um mercado consumidor para seus produtos, fabricados na lógica da produção capitalista de mercadorias, mas com apelos à preservação ambiental. Nesse sentido, observam-se o crescimento e a difusão de filmes infantis sobre a temática ambiental que vêm constantemente invadindo espaços da sociedade, entre eles a escola. Considerando essa problemática, a obra analisa, ainda, as razões que motivam os professores dos primeiros anos do ensino básico a utilizarem filmes infantis quando abordam a questão ambiental em suas aulas. Por se tratar de um tema contemporâneo, a leitura deste livro é indispensável aos professores que – conscientes da urgência e da necessidade de abordagens críticas em suas aulas – poderão encontrar aqui reflexões significativas sobre a temática ambiental.

For students of design, professional product designers, and anyone interested in design equally indispensable: the fully revised and updated edition of the reference work on product design. The book traces the history of product design and its current developments, and presents the most important principles of design theory and methodology, looking in particular at the communicative function of products and highlighting aspects such as corporate and service design, design management, strategic design, interface/interaction design and human design.. From the content: Design and history: The Bauhaus; The Ulm School of Design; The Example of Braun; The Art of Design Design and Globalization Design and Methodology: Epistemological Methods in Design Design and Theory: Aspects of the Disciplinary Design Theory Design and its Context: From Corporate Design to Service Design Product Language and Product Semiotics Architecture and Design Design and Society Design and Technological Progress

Exploring the interplay between globalization, education and international development, this book surveys the impact of global education policies on local policy in developing countries. With chapters written by leading international scholars, drawing on a full range of theoretical perspectives and offering a diverse selection of case studies from Africa, Asia and South America, this book considers such topics as: How are global education agendas and policies formed and implemented? What is the impact of such policy priorities as public-private partnerships, child-centred pedagogies and school-based management? What are the effects of political and economic globalization on educational reform and change? How do mediating institutions affect the translation of global policies to particular educational contexts? What are the limitations of globalised policy solutions and what problems do they encounter at local levels? From students of education, development and globalization to practitioners working in developing contexts, this book is an important resource for those seeking to understand how global forces and local realities meet to shape education policy in the developing world.

Virtual learning environments are widely spread in higher education, yet they are often under utilised by the institutions that employ them. This book addresses the need to move beyond thinking about the VLE simply in terms of the particular package that an institution has adopted, and viewing it as a significant educational technology that will shape much of the teaching and learning process in the coming years. Considering how virtual learning environments can be successfully deployed and used for effective teaching, it sets out a model for effective use, focussing on pedagogic application rather than a specific technology, and seeks to provide a bridge between pedagogical approaches and the tools educators have at their disposal. It contains essential advice for those choosing a VLE and encourages all those involved in the deployment of a VLEs to use them more productively in order to create engaging learning experiences.
